Flood Risk Context for Buncombe County

Buncombe County in North Carolina has a median home value of $328,900 and median household income of $66,531. A major flood event could cause up to $82,225 in damage to a median-value home.

Flood insurance costs vary significantly based on your specific flood zone, elevation, building characteristics, and claims history. The estimates above are county-level approximations. Use our calculator for a personalized analysis with Monte Carlo simulation of 10,000 flood scenarios.
